ROA
Return on Assets, a financial ratio indicating how profitable a company is relative to its total assets, measuring how efficiently those assets are used to generate profit.
Total Asset Turnover
A ratio calculating how effectively a company utilizes its assets to produce sales income.
Return on Equity
A measure of a corporation's profitability, indicated by the amount of net income returned as a percentage of shareholders equity.
